Nice to see a Shiraz from Australia that is under 14% alcohol, unfortunately for my taste it has a little too much jammy notes, but those that like low tannin wines will like this wine
Tasting Note: Medium to light ruby in colour with good acidity, a medium+ intense nose, low tannin & average length on the finish. Wine features plum, blueberry pie, strawberry jam & white pepper.
Negatives: None
Pairings: Drink now or over the next 3-5 years on its own or pair it with seared venison with blueberry sauce.
